41K Series 930 CAT Loader: Key Features, Troubleshooting, and Maintenance
#1
Introduction
The 41K Series 930 CAT loader is a versatile and durable piece of machinery widely used in construction, agriculture, and other industries. This article covers the main features of the loader, common issues that operators face, and troubleshooting tips to keep the machine running efficiently.
Key Features of the 41K Series 930 CAT Loader
  • Engine Performance: The 930 CAT loader is equipped with a powerful engine designed for efficient fuel consumption and reliable power output. It’s ideal for a range of tasks including lifting, loading, and material handling.
  • Hydraulic System: The loader’s hydraulic system is built to handle heavy loads with ease. It ensures smooth operation for attachments such as buckets, forks, or grapples.
  • Transmission and Drive: The 930 loader features a robust transmission that provides excellent control over speed and torque. Its heavy-duty driveline ensures the machine can handle tough terrains and operations.
  • Operator Comfort: The 41K series offers an ergonomically designed cab with modern controls, ensuring comfort and reducing operator fatigue during long shifts.
  • Advanced Safety Features: Built-in safety features include an advanced braking system, secure rollover protection, and visibility enhancements to ensure operator safety.
Common Issues with the 41K Series 930 CAT Loader
  1. Hydraulic System Leaks: One of the most common issues faced by operators is hydraulic fluid leakage, especially around hoses, fittings, and seals. This can lead to decreased performance and potential damage to the hydraulic components.
  2. Transmission Slipping or Hesitation: Operators may notice issues with the transmission, such as slipping or delayed engagement. This can be caused by low transmission fluid, a faulty clutch, or issues with the hydraulic pumps driving the transmission system.
  3. Overheating Engine: Overheating can occur when the engine is under excessive load or when the cooling system is not functioning properly. Clogged radiator fins, low coolant levels, or damaged thermostats can all contribute to this issue.
  4. Electrical System Malfunctions: Problems with the loader’s electrical system, such as malfunctioning sensors, battery issues, or faulty wiring, can cause operational failures or alert warnings to the operator.
  5. Poor Lifting Performance: When the loader struggles to lift or handle loads, it could be due to issues with the hydraulic pump, pressure relief valves, or a worn-out hydraulic cylinder.
Troubleshooting and Solutions
  1. Hydraulic Leaks: Inspect all hoses, seals, and fittings for visible signs of damage or wear. Replace any cracked or damaged parts immediately. Regularly check hydraulic fluid levels and ensure there’s no contamination in the fluid.
  2. Transmission Issues: If the transmission is slipping or hesitant, check the fluid levels and quality. Low or contaminated fluid can impair transmission performance. If the fluid is in good condition, the issue might lie with the clutch or transmission components, which may require further inspection or servicing.
  3. Engine Overheating: To address overheating, first, check coolant levels and ensure the radiator is free of debris. Clean the radiator fins and replace any faulty thermostats. If overheating persists, inspect the water pump and radiator hoses for leaks or damage.
  4. Electrical Problems: Perform a diagnostic check using the onboard system to identify any sensor or electrical system malfunctions. Test the battery voltage, check wiring connections, and replace faulty sensors or damaged wiring. It’s important to also inspect the alternator and charging system to ensure proper function.
  5. Poor Lifting Performance: If the loader is struggling with lifting, check the hydraulic system for leaks or pressure drops. Inspect hydraulic cylinders and the pump for wear. Replace damaged cylinders or repair the pump if necessary.
Preventive Maintenance Tips
  • Regular Fluid Checks: Ensure that hydraulic fluid, transmission fluid, and engine oil levels are checked regularly. Changing fluids on time can help prevent clogs, overheating, and mechanical failures.
  • Daily Inspections: Before each use, inspect the loader for leaks, visible wear, and damage. Tighten any loose bolts, check the tires, and ensure the hydraulic system is functioning properly.
  • Air Filter Maintenance: Clean or replace air filters periodically to ensure that the engine breathes clean air, preventing dust and debris from causing damage to the engine components.
  • Cab Maintenance: Keep the operator’s cab clean and ensure that all control levers, gauges, and displays are functioning correctly. This will reduce the chance of operator fatigue and improve safety.
  • Lubrication: Regularly lubricate all moving parts and joints, such as the loader arms and bucket hinges, to prevent excessive wear and tear.
